What's Coming

Thanks to the passage of Issue 9, promises made are being kept and we will be upgrading our recreation facilities. The conceptual plans for a new aquatic and community center were presented to the public on October 19, 2021.  Additionally, the city received a TLCI grant from the Northeast Ohio Areawide Coordinating Agency (NOACA), that made possible a comprehensive, city-wide study to identify long-term objectives for community connectivity via non-motorized trails. We are working to increase community pride with these new additions to the city. See this video explaining Phase I & II of the parks and pool project.
